Early 20th Century Pair of Sterling Tablespoons by Gorham
About the Item
Antique pair of sterling silver tablespoons, Duke of York pattern by Gorham. Pattern patented Dec. 1, 1900. Period monogram, "EAF". 3.75 troy oz. Estate of Linda Kornberg.
8 1/4" long.
